Sur National Geographic:

National Geographic Partners LLC (NGP), une coentreprise entre Disney et le National Geographic Society, s’engage à livrer au monde des contenus scientifiques, d’aventure et d’exploration de premier ordre à travers un portefeuille inégalé d’actifs multimédias. NGP combine les chaînes de télévision mondiales de National Geographic (National Geographic Channel, Nat Geo WILD, Nat Geo MUNDO, Nat Geo PEOPLE) et les actifs orientés sur les médias et les consommateurs du National Geographic, dont les magazines National Geographic ; les studios National Geographic ; les plateformes de médias numériques et sociaux associées ; les livres, les cartes, les médias pour enfants et les activités auxiliaires qui incluent voyages, expériences et événements internationaux, vente d’archives, octroi de licences et activités de commerce électronique. L’avancement des connaissances et de la compréhension de notre monde est l’objectif principal du National Geographic depuis 131 ans, et nous nous engageons désormais à approfondir, repousser les limites, aller plus loin pour nos consommateurs... et ce faisant à toucher des millions de personnes autour du monde dans 172 pays et 43 langues chaque mois. NGP remet 27 % de nos recettes à l’organisme à but non lucratif National Geographic Society en vue de financer des travaux dans les domaines de la science, de l’exploration, de la conservation et de l’éducation.

Sur The Walt Disney Company:

The Walt Disney Company, ainsi que ses filiales et sociétés affiliées, forme l’une des principales entreprises internationales diversifiées de divertissement familial et de médias. Elle comprend trois secteurs d'activités essentiels : Disney Entertainment, ESPN et Disney Experiences. Depuis ses modestes débuts en tant que studio de dessins animés dans les années 1920 jusqu’à son statut de référence actuel dans le secteur du divertissement, Disney poursuit fièrement sa tradition de création d’histoires et d’expériences exceptionnelles pour tous les membres de la famille. Les histoires, les personnages et les expériences de Disney touchent les consommateurs et les visiteurs du monde entier. À travers nos activités présentes dans plus de 40 pays, nos employés et cast members collaborent pour créer des expériences de divertissement appréciées à la fois au niveau universel et local.
